Installation Guide Order the PX051 (sediment cartridge) & CB951 (carbon cartridge) for a replacement cartridges and RET1812-75 replacement membrane to suit your PRO270 system. Membrane housing cap can be unscrewed by hand. 3. Cleanse the inside of the housing using Puretec S500 Sanitiser. Check O-ring and lubricate with food grade silicone lubricant or similar. Replace O-ring if kinked or damaged.
